WEST COAST OFFENDERS

P.A. GREYMOUTH, Aug. 4. When accosted by a detective in the street in Reefton early on Saturday afternoon, Frederick Francis Archer, aged 39, a furnisher, and Roderick McLean, aged 51, a pensioner, both admitted that they had been bookmaking. Each man was fined £25 by Justices of the Peace.
